Output d987c44c10129cb5a319edbe5ccb73eb2d8cbd17304ee07e6f53618a2c9f9acd:1

value
534182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c309885c3e61e2435551268741a1f8ffc0588129 OP_EQUAL
address
3KUH7HrL28RFonSX1MMnygDthF7Z47td62
transaction
d987c44c10129cb5a319edbe5ccb73eb2d8cbd17304ee07e6f53618a2c9f9acd
spent
true